1. Innovations in Dental Implant Technology

The field of dental implants has seen significant advancements in technology, changing the way we approach oral health. Modern implants are now crafted from biocompatible materials, which fuse seamlessly with the jawbone to ensure stability and durability. The shift from traditional materials to titanium and zirconia has revolutionized the longevity and success rates of these implants.
Moreover, 3D imaging and computer-aided design (CAD) have enhanced the precision of implant placements. These technologies allow dentists to create customized treatment plans tailored to each patients unique anatomical structures, leading to better outcomes and reduced recovery times.
In addition, the advent of guided implant surgery techniques has minimized invasiveness. Surgeons now use sophisticated templates to ensure accurate placement, resulting in greater patient comfort and streamlined procedures. These technological innovations not only improve surgical efficiency but also enhance the overall patient experience.
2. Enhancing Aesthetic and Functional Outcomes
Dental implants are not just about replacing missing teeth; they significantly enhance a persons smile and overall facial aesthetics. With advancements in implant design and materials, patients can achieve natural-looking results that blend seamlessly with their existing teeth. The careful selection of shade and contour ensures that the new implant mimics the appearance of real teeth.
Functionally, dental implants restore the ability to chew and speak without discomfort. Many patients report that they can eat their favorite foods again, which positively impacts their quality of life. Improved speech is another significant benefit; patients no longer struggle with pronunciation or slurring sounds due to gaps or loose dentures.
Furthermore, by preventing bone loss in the jaw, dental implants contribute to the preservation of facial structures, avoiding the sunken appearance associated with missing teeth. This advantage ensures that patients not only feel better but also look healthier and more youthful after receiving treatment.

4. Future Trends in Dental Implant Treatments
As the field of dentistry continues to evolve, future trends in dental implant treatments are set to elevate patient care further. Research into innovative materials—such as bioactive ceramics—holds potential for even more effective healing and integration with the body.
Additionally, personalized medicine is becoming increasingly relevant in dental care. Tailoring treatment plans based on genetic predisposition may optimize recovery and success rates for implants, ensuring a customized experience for each patient.
Furthermore, the integ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ning is poised to revolutionize diagnostic processes and procedural planning. These advancements will allow for quicker, more accurate assessments, leading to higher success rates and improved outcomes for dental implant procedures.
